标题:Vue3开发微信小程序,助力开发者快速打造优质应用
随着智能手机的普及,微信小程序的应用越来越广泛,成为企业及个人推广与服务的重要渠道。而在小程序开发中,选择合适的技术框架显得尤为重要。Vue3作为一款颇受欢迎且功能强大的框架,其应用在微信小程序的开发中备受推崇。本文将为您详细介绍Vue3开发微信小程序的优势,并为开发者提供指导,助力打造出优质的小程序应用。
一、Vue3框架的优势
1. 性能出众:Vue3通过虚拟DOM的计算和比对,使得渲染性能得到了大幅提升。在微信小程序中,这意味着更快的页面渲染速度和更好的用户体验。
2. 数据响应式:Vue3采用了新的响应式数据设计,使数据变得更加灵活,开发者能够轻松地对数据进行监听、计算和触发。这一特性在微信小程序开发中尤为重要,能够帮助开发者快速响应用户操作并更新页面。
3. 组件化开发:Vue3采用了组件化的开发模式,将一个页面拆分成多个独立的组件,使得代码更加可复用、维护起来更加简单。在微信小程序的开发中,多采用复杂组件的方式来实现功能,Vue3的组件化开发能够极大地提高代码的可读性和可维护性。
4. 生态完善:Vue3作为一款开源的框架,有庞大的开发者社区和活跃度,配套工具和插件也十分丰富。开发者在遇到问题时,能够快速找到解决方案,大大节省开发时间。
二、Vue3开发微信小程序的步骤
1. 环境准备:开发者首先需要安装微信开发者工具、node.js以及Vue CLI。Vue CLI是官方提供的一款脚手架工具,能够快速生成项目结构和配置工程化的开发环境。
2. 创建项目:通过Vue CLI可以轻松创建一个Vue3的项目,指定小程序作为目标平台。同时,还可以配置项目的基本信息、页面和组件的目录结构等。
3. 开发页面:Vue3中的页面文件使用单文件组件的形式进行开发,包含HTML模板、JavaScript逻辑和CSS样式。开发者可以按需引入微信小程序提供的API,进行交互逻辑的编写。
4. 开发组件:将页面拆分成多个组件,通过props和emit进行组件间的通信,使得代码更加模块化。同时,可以通过Vue3提供的Composition API编写自定义的逻辑,使得组件逻辑更加简洁和可读。
5. 打包发布:完成开发后,开发者可以通过Vue CLI提供的打包工具,将项目打包成小程序的可执行文件,并上传至微信开发者工具进行测试和发布。
三、Vue3开发微信小程序的案例
1. 小程序商城:通过Vue3开发微信小程序商城,可以快速实现商品展示、购物车、下单等功能,提供便捷的购物体验。同时,Vue3的组件化开发和响应式数据能够使商城页面更具交互性和动态性。
2. 教育类小程序:以在线教育为例,通过Vue3开发微信小程序,可以实现学生、教师、课程等功能模块的开发。通过Vue3的生态工具和社区资源,提供更丰富的教育资源和学习体验。
结语:
Vue3作为一款领先的前端框架,在微信小程序开发中发挥着巨大作用。其出众的性能、响应式数据和组件化开发为开发者提供了丰富的开发方案,并帮助更多的开发者快速打造优质的小程序应用。相信随着Vue3的持续发展,将会有更多的开发者加入到Vue3开发微信小程序的行列中,并为用户带来更好的体验。